Verizon Wireless customers can donate $10 to the Red Cross by texting REDCROSS to 90999 or to the Salvation Army by texting STORM to 80888. Those who would like to give more can donate up to $50 via text. Text messaging fees will be waived and 100 percent of each donation goes directly to the Red Cross and/or Salvation Army.

This year, the college basketball tournament broke online streaming records. Weeks later, the 2013 Masters Golf Tournament also drew a big online audience, further solidifying that online streaming is a key part of the future of live sporting events. With televised sporting events going mobile, viewers no longer need to be tied to the couch to watch the game live.
